assume that you are walking away from a motion sensor that is connected to a computer which will draw a position vs. time graph for your motion. predict (sketch) the position vs. time graph for the motion at a constant velocity towards the motion sensor. attach your sketch here.
When moving towards a motion - sensor at a constant velocity, the position (distance from the sensor) decreases linearly with time. So, the position - vs - time graph will be a straight - line with a negative slope. The y - intercept represents the initial position (distance from the sensor at time t = 0), and as time progresses, the position value on the y - axis decreases steadily.
